When does the ABS light come on on a Navara?
Your Nissan Navara’s ABS Light comes on when it fails a self diagnostic cycle. When on, it indicates that the Navara does not have Anti-Lock brakes, and the safety they provide. Your Navara’s ABS system uses a system of sensors to determine wheel speed when braking.
Is it safe to start a Nissan Navara D40?
Nissan Navara D40 Glow Plug indicator light (diesel engine only). When ignition is turned on this light will illuminate. It is only safe to start the engine when this light goes off, it illuminates because the engine is cold, when the light is illuminated the pre heating of the engine is active.
What does the red exclamation mark mean on a Nissan Navara?
Warning light name: Nissan Navara / Frontier brake warning light. Description: The red exclamation mark is the brake warning light symbol. In some areas, the symbol may be in the red text form of BRAKE. It indicates that the: ▷ Parking brake: The parking brake has not been properly released.
